From b5a78844f133df64c5fa1d61e44b545003f7864e Mon Sep 17 00:00:00 2001 From: Masahiro FUJIMOTO Date: Sun, 28 Jul 2024 14:46:35 +0900 Subject: [PATCH] =?UTF-8?q?2024/07/19=20=E6=99=82=E7=82=B9=E3=81=AE?= =?UTF-8?q?=E8=8B=B1=E8=AA=9E=E7=89=88=E3=81=AB=E5=9F=BA=E3=81=A5=E3=81=8D?= =?UTF-8?q?=E6=9B=B4=E6=96=B0?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../web/api/htmlmediaelement/sinkid/index.md | 26 +++++++++++++++---- 1 file changed, 21 insertions(+), 5 deletions(-) diff --git a/files/ja/web/api/htmlmediaelement/sinkid/index.md b/files/ja/web/api/htmlmediaelement/sinkid/index.md index 973ffebcfd6e7c..7d68a005f42de7 100644 --- a/files/ja/web/api/htmlmediaelement/sinkid/index.md +++ b/files/ja/web/api/htmlmediaelement/sinkid/index.md @@ -1,17 +1,27 @@ --- -title: HTMLMediaElement.sinkId +title: "HTMLMediaElement: sinkId プロパティ" +short-title: sinkId slug: Web/API/HTMLMediaElement/sinkId l10n: - sourceCommit: 277e5969c63b97cfb55ab4a0e612e8040810f49b + sourceCommit: 3df177b401e00e3a855c40fc074b5ef2469b700d --- -{{SeeCompatTable}}{{APIRef("HTML DOM")}} +{{APIRef("Audio Output Devices API")}}{{securecontext_header}} -**`HTMLMediaElement.sinkId`** は読み取り専用プロパティで、出力を配信する音声機器の固有の ID である文字列を返します。ユーザーエージェントの既定で使用されている場合は、空文字列を返します。この ID は {{domxref("MediaDevices.enumerateDevices()")}}、`id-multimedia`、`id-communications` から返される値のいずれかである必要があります。 +**`sinkId`** は {{domxref("HTMLMediaElement")}} インターフェイスの読み取り専用プロパティで、出力を配信する音声機器の固有の ID である文字列を返します。 + +この ID は {{domxref("MediaDevices.enumerateDevices()")}} から返される {{domxref("MediaDeviceInfo.deviceId")}} の値、`id-multimedia`、`id-communications` のいずれかである必要があります。 +ユーザーエージェントの既定の機器が使用されている場合は、空文字列を返します。 ## 値 -文字列です。 +出力を配信する音声機器の固有の ID である文字列を返します。ユーザーエージェントの既定の機器が使用されている場合は、空文字列を返します。 + +## セキュリティの要件 + +このプロパティにアクセスするには、以下の制約があります。 + +- このプロパティは、[安全なコンテキスト](/ja/docs/Web/Security/Secure_Contexts)で呼び出す必要があります。 ## 仕様書 @@ -20,3 +30,9 @@ l10n: ## ブラウザーの互換性 {{Compat}} + +## 関連情報 + +- [オーディオ出力機器 API](/ja/docs/Web/API/Audio_Output_Devices_API) +- {{domxref("MediaDevices.selectAudioOutput()")}} +- {{domxref("HTMLMediaElement.setSinkId()")}}